The recent Health and Safety Legislation changes in New Zealand (Health and Safety at Work Act 2015) have provided a legislative framework which specifically highlights the responsibility that we all have for our health and safety in the work place. Fully understanding hazards and risks in the work place is a core premise and there is now a requirement to ensure that ‘reasonably practicable’ steps to safeguard the work place are put into place.

 

In the context of ‘social hazards’, such as work related-stress and working long hours; Responsive Consulting consider ‘health and safety’ and ‘well-being’ to be two sides of the same coin. Identifying and quantifying these hazards is complex and there is a danger of inaccurately estimating these risks due to the role of emotion and unconscious bias. Once identified supporting the individual, team and organisational resilience to manage these facilitates a pro-active health and safety culture.

 

Similarly the understanding, estimation and management of risk are considered the other side of the resilience coin. There are some events that are more predictable than others and work place stress is a common reaction to change. Indeed, events such as natural disasters have emphasised the power and impact of resilience. Therefore pro-actively building resilience alongside risk management facilitates the successful sustainability of an organisation.
